Transaction 8899172e124bb2bf2cb459cd2172ddc0c7075524767a4f9a55d75882da1c7023
1 Input
1 Output
-
8899172e124bb2bf2cb459cd2172ddc0c7075524767a4f9a55d75882da1c7023:0
- value
- 520223
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cd0ce8a85d52155b60722d7d19125f787eac1be3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KhCzFFZNPHjysuMZHabeod4w6CTftmQf6